Block 589,506

000000000000000000033490627b56298003a0b559b2c7d565e7104c871c05d5
345,660 confirmations
Timestamp
1565458651
Tx count3,070
Traces0
Avg fee12,131 sats
view on mempool.space

Transactions

No transactions found.

Showing 0 / 0